A lady who supposedly attacked council animal compliance officers on a North-West beach has actually rejected the charges put versus her.
According to The Advocate, Penguin dog owner Judith Elizabeth Murphy was verbally violent towards council officers at Johnson’s Beach in February 2022, prior to supposedly punching an officer 3 times in the shoulder and striking her with a dog leash.
The event followed Murphy declined to reveal her dog’s registration tag in an expected off-lead location for dogs.
A member of the general public who saw the occasion informed the court the officers were being “quite aggressive” in the method they were speaking with Murphy, stating they might “seize her dog and have it put down”.
Judith Murphy pleaded innocent to the charges, and the hearing will resume in September.
